                        I really don't think those type of results are possible in such a short time frame. I wouldn't rule out the possibility that you could achieve such regrowth without a transplant, but it seems unlikely. You would probably need to be on dut, spiro, and a topical like RU to even think about getting that kind of regrowth and it may take years. I remember reading about a 70 year old who was bald for decades but began taking spiro for heart problems or something. It took 5 years, but even his follicles started to regenerate and he experienced regrowth.
